That error usually means the task raised an exception class that’s “frozen” (e.g., a
@dataclass(frozen=True)
or a Pydantic model configured as frozen) so Python can’t set its
__traceback__
attribute when the exception is raised. It’s a Python limitation, not specific to Prefect. In Prefect 3.x, failures are captured into a Failed state (see how exceptions are handled in prefect.states), but the underlying issue here is the exception object itself being immutable. What to do: - If it’s your exception class, remove “frozen”:
Copy code
# problematic
  @dataclass(frozen=True)
  class MyError(Exception):
      msg: str

  # fix
  @dataclass  # no frozen=True
  class MyError(Exception):
      msg: str
- If it comes from a third‑party library, catch and re‑raise a standard mutable exception:
Copy code
try:
      call_library()
  except SomeFrozenLibError as e:
      raise RuntimeError(f"Upstream error: {e}") from e
